1) Start With a Social Media Marketing Plan

  • What are you hoping to achieve through social media marketing?

  • Who is your target audience?

  • How can you reach your audience? 

  • Where would your target audience hang out and how would they use social media?

  • What message do you want to send to your audience with social media marketing?

  • How can you make the best reels and graphics to attract more customers? 


2) Create Social Media Content Planner

  • Consistent with other areas of online marketing, content reigns supreme when it comes to social media marketing.

  • Make sure you post regularly and offer truly valuable information that your ideal customers will find helpful and interesting.

  • The content that you share on your social networks can include social media images, videos, infographics, how-to guides, eye-catching graph, and much more. 



3) Do a Proper Social Media Competitor Analysis


  • It’s always important to keep an eye on competitors. They can provide valuable data for keyword research and other social media marketing insight. Check the and research about their audience. 

  • If your competitors are using a certain social media marketing channel or technique that seems to be working for them, consider doing the same thing, but do it better!

  • It is essential to focus on keywords and the target audience also needs to check the captions of each post, to ensure the establishment of a healthy presence for hotel social media.

5 KEY COMPONENTS TO AN EFFECTIVE REVENUE & PROFIT STRATEGY- Hospitality Minds

Looking to increase revenue in 2019? Get in line. The desire to generate more revenue is nothing new to hoteliers, but the journey toward higher revenues and greater profitability requires hotels to take a more holistic approach; one that implements technology that leverages data from disparate sources to develop actionable intelligence to help stimulate and optimize demand. Let’s take a closer look at five important areas of focus for your revenue journey. Channel Segmentation Your distribution channels – online, off-line, direct, and indirect – should be segmented and analyzed by guest type and acquisition cost. This lets you to determine where your most valuable mix of bookings and revenue is coming from. With OTAs charging hefty commissions, sometimes as, high as 30 %  you want a distribution strategy that drives as much direct business as possible. It’s important to regularly review your channel mix to ensure that it’s profitable and aligned with your property goals.
